The PDF reader is working properly (though hangs sometimes) compared to Kobo Sage; it also support more advanced formatting options. The non-distracting design and the good grip of its back side, table of contents folding, USB C, SD card slot are bonuses as well. Sorry: - I still was paying attention to a bit lower-than-usual resolution of the screen while reading. This prevented reading some of the PDFs full-page in portrait mode defeating the purpose of the purchase. (Though some "good" PDFs were readable in portrait, especially with the handy margin cropping feature.) - The uneven backlight was a bit distracting when reading in the dark as well, especially in landscape that I had to use with some PDFs. - It was also surprising that auto-brightness was not using a sensor but time of the day, which never worked well for me. - The user interface of the library/home screen was scaled up too much that I felt like I was navigating an oversized 6 inch reader. - Very often auto-rotation did not work well and I had to turn it again to trigger the orientation change. There were some smaller glitches like that, e.g. double presses on the power button not recognized sometimes. - The hardware buttons are positioned well (unlike Kobo Sage, where they are too far apart) but it was hard to distinguish them in the dark because of the flush design.

Initially I was disappointed with the sharpness of the letters on the screen, because I am used to the Inkpad 3. In addition, you can't set the exposure as soft red as the 3; it is rather yellow. I also thought I would miss listening to music or audiobooks. But all objections actually disappear when you consider that the Inkpad Lite offers the same versatility as the 3. What I like is that you don't necessarily have to be online to transfer books. It is a closed system, which also works quickly. Only if the letters are small do you miss sharpness. But from font 11, the image is perfect for me. The size of 9.7 inches means you can read PDFs with ease and frankly even better than on the 3. The zoom options, manual or automatic, are very well designed. You can even adjust how dark the background or foreground appears, so that any text or image is clearly visible (you can even remove the blur with it). I just had to learn the best way to hold the Lite, because I had to get used to the buttons, which are now on the right. I also really like the weight. I use the Inkpad Lite purely for reading, but you can also browse the internet, draw, calculate and play a few games. That all works very well. If it ever got a sharper screen or the option for audio, it would be perfect for me. But I'm very happy with it at the moment.
